Henry Balfour Gardiner
Henry Balfour Gardiner (1877-1950) was an English musician, composer and teacher. Gardiner taught music briefly at Winchester College, collected English folk music and composed a very limited amount of music himself.

His best known work, Evening Hymn is a lush, romantic, work of dense harmonies and is considered a classic of the English choral repertoire. It is still regularly performed as an Anthem at Evensong in Anglican Churches.

In his later years, Gardiner gave up on public musical life to concentrate on an afforestation programme on his Dorset farm.

He is the great uncle of prominent conductor John Eliot Gardiner.
